Features of the Dogwood Crime Map
The crime map for Dogwood offers several useful features, including:
- Crime Categories: Visual icons and colors distinguish between theft, assault, vandalism, and other crimes.
- Time Filters: View data from specific periods to identify trends over days, weeks, or months.
- Heat Maps: Highlight areas with higher concentrations of criminal activity for quick visual assessment.
- Incident Details: Click on individual reports to learn more about the nature, date, and exact location of each incident.

Tips for Staying Safe in Dogwood
While the crime map is a helpful resource, personal vigilance is key. Consider these safety tips:
- Stay Informed: Regularly review the crime map and local news updates.
- Report Suspicious Activity: Contact local authorities if you observe anything unusual.
- Community Engagement: Join neighborhood watch groups or community safety initiatives.
- Secure Your Property: Use locks, security systems, and outdoor lighting to deter criminals.
